Automatically Refresh Token for 401 Unauthorized

Demonstrates how to automatically refresh an access token (without user interaction) when the token expires and a 401 Unauthorized response is received.

<?php

$success = 0;

// This example requires the Chilkat API to have been previously unlocked.
// See Global Unlock Sample for sample code.

$tokenFilePath = 'qa_data/tokens/googleCalendar.json';

// Get our current access token.
$jsonToken = new COM("Chilkat.JsonObject");
$success = $jsonToken->LoadFile($tokenFilePath);
if ($jsonToken->HasMember('access_token') == 0) {
    print 'No access token found.' . "\n";
    exit;
}

$http = new COM("Chilkat.Http");
$http->AuthToken = $jsonToken->stringOf('access_token');

$jsonResponse = $http->quickGetStr('https://www.googleapis.com/calendar/v3/users/me/calendarList');
if ($http->LastMethodSuccess != 1) {

    if ($http->LastStatus != 401) {
        print $http->LastErrorText . "\n";
        print '----' . "\n";
        print $http->LastResponseBody . "\n";
        exit;
    }

    // The access token must've expired. 
    // Refresh the access token and then retry the request.
    $oauth2 = new COM("Chilkat.OAuth2");

    $oauth2->TokenEndpoint = 'https://www.googleapis.com/oauth2/v4/token';

    // Replace these with actual values.
    $oauth2->ClientId = 'GOOGLE-CLIENT-ID';
    $oauth2->ClientSecret = 'GOOGLE-CLIENT-SECRET';

    // Get the "refresh_token"
    $oauth2->RefreshToken = $jsonToken->stringOf('refresh_token');

    // Send the HTTP POST to refresh the access token..
    $success = $oauth2->RefreshAccessToken();
    if ($success != 1) {
        print $oauth2->LastErrorText . "\n";
        exit;
    }

    // The response contains a new access token, but we must keep
    // our existing refresh token for when we need to refresh again in the future.
    $jsonToken->UpdateString('access_token',$oauth2->AccessToken);

    // Save the new JSON access token response to a file.
    $sbJson = new COM("Chilkat.StringBuilder");
    $jsonToken->EmitCompact = 0;
    $jsonToken->EmitSb($sbJson);
    $sbJson->WriteFile($tokenFilePath,'utf-8',0);

    print 'OAuth2 authorization granted!' . "\n";
    print 'New Access Token = ' . $oauth2->AccessToken . "\n";

    // re-try the original request.
    $http->AuthToken = $oauth2->AccessToken;
    $jsonResponse = $http->quickGetStr('https://www.googleapis.com/calendar/v3/users/me/calendarList');
    if ($http->LastMethodSuccess != 1) {
        print $http->LastErrorText . "\n";
        exit;
    }

}

print $jsonResponse . "\n";
print '-----------------------------' . "\n";

?>
